Hi team — quick heads up that Thursday is the DR drill for the Garrowfield parking-garage occupancy feed. Expect the live counts to freeze for about ten minutes while we fail over to the Bellwick replica. Tell any callers it's planned. To bring the replica's feed cache back online, you'll enter the standby passphrase, which follows below.

strongbox words: fraath-isteth

## Leadership Review Briefing: Warranty-Cost Overrun — Tilbrook Line

For heads of department. Warranty claims on the Tilbrook appliance line are running 38% above plan, driven by a compressor seal defect traced to the Averlon supplier batch. Corrective tooling is in place; claims should normalize within two quarters. Reserve adjustments will appear in the next forecast. Supplier recovery negotiations are underway. How this affects our forward plans is outlined in the confidential note below.

confidential, bahap-bajog: Zorethix Works is in early talks to buy Kelethox Foods for about $30.7 million. The Ralvan launch date is September 19, and nothing goes to the press before then.

## Thumbnail Queue — Environments

The Pixelforge thumbnail generation queue runs in three environments: dev, staging, and prod. Each environment has its own worker pool and retry policy; dev workers process at reduced concurrency to keep costs down. Jobs are enqueued by the upload service and drained in FIFO order, with oversized images routed to a slow lane. As a contractor you'll mostly touch staging. The staging environment uses the following configuration values.

service settings:
WENATH_PIN=5007
WENATH_METRICS_HOST=metrics.wenath.tolvaqlabs.corp
WENATH_LOG_LEVEL=debug
WENATH_TENANT=rusox